Trump administration launches two new civil rights investigations into Harvard University
The Department of Education announced two new civil rights investigations into Harvard University on Monday. One investigation examines whether Harvard continues to use race-based preferences in admissions despite the 2023 Supreme Court ruling banning affirmative action. The second investigation focuses on alleged antisemitism on campus and failure to protect Jewish students.
